    439 # IDE drives
    440 # Flags are used only with controllers that support DMA operations
    441 # and mode settings (e.g. some pciide controllers)
    442 # The lowest order four bits (rightmost digit) of the flags define the PIO
    443 # mode to use, the next set of four bits the DMA mode and the third set the
    444 # UltraDMA mode. For each set of four bits, the 3 lower bits define the mode
    445 # to use, and the last bit must be 1 for this setting to be used.
    446 # For DMA and UDMA, 0xf (1111) means 'disable'.
    447 # 0x0fac means 'use PIO mode 4, DMA mode 2, disable UltraDMA'.
    448 # (0xc=1100, 0xa=1010, 0xf=1111)
    449 # 0x0000 means "use whatever the drive claims to support".

    849 
    850 # pci backend devices, used for PCI pass-through. To export a PCI device
    851 # to a domU, the device has to be attached to the pciback driver in the dom0.
    852 # you can force a device to attach to the pciback driver in dom0 passing
    853 # pciback.hide=(bus:dev.fun)(bus:dev.func) to the dom0 kernel boot parameters.
    854 # bus and dev are 2-digits hex number, func is a single-digit number:
    855 # pciback.hide=(00:1a.0)(00:1a.1)(00:1a.7)
    856 pciback* at pci?			#pci backend device
